30222102133311 has 16 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 43986540067968. Its totient is φ = 18305126042400.

The previous prime is 30222102133273. The next prime is 30222102133313. The reversal of 30222102133311 is 11333120122203.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 30222102133311 - 27 = 30222102133183 is a prime.

It is a congruent number.

It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(30222102133313)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written in 15 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 282433021 + ... + 282540006.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(2749158754248).

Almost surely, 230222102133311 is an apocalyptic number.

30222102133311 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(13764437934657).

30222102133311 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.

30222102133311 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.

The sum of its prime factors is 564974662.

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 1296, while the sum is 24.

Adding to 30222102133311 its reverse (11333120122203), we get a palindrome (41555222255514).
